 /*
  *   PERL_FLEXIBLE_EXCEPTIONS
- * 
+ *
  * All the flexible exceptions code has been removed.
  * See the following threads for details:
  *
- *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/2004-07/msg00378.html
- * 
+ *   Message-Id: 20040713143217.GB1424@plum.flirble.org
+ *   https://www.nntp.perl.org/group/perl.perl5.porters/2004/07/msg93041.html
+ *
  * Joshua's original patches (which weren't applied) and discussion:
- * 
+ *
  *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/1998-02/msg01396.html
  *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/1998-02/msg01489.html
  *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/1998-02/msg01491.html
  *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/1998-02/msg01608.html
  *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/1998-02/msg02144.html
  *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/1998-02/msg02998.html
- * 
+ *
  * Chip's reworked patch and discussion:
- * 
+ *
  *   http://www.xray.mpe.mpg.de/mailing-lists/perl5-porters/1999-03/msg00520.html
- * 
+ *
  * The flaw in these patches (which went unnoticed at the time) was
  * that they moved some code that could potentially die() out of the
  * region protected by the setjmp()s.  This caused exceptions within
  * END blocks and such to not be handled by the correct setjmp().
- * 
+ *
  * The original patches that introduces flexible exceptions were:
  *
- * http://perl5.git.perl.org/perl.git/commit/312caa8e97f1c7ee342a9895c2f0e749625b4929
- * http://perl5.git.perl.org/perl.git/commit/14dd3ad8c9bf82cf09798a22cc89a9862dfd6d1a                                        
- *  
+ * https://github.com/Perl/perl5/commit/312caa8e97f1c7ee342a9895c2f0e749625b4929
+ * https://github.com/Perl/perl5/commit/14dd3ad8c9bf82cf09798a22cc89a9862dfd6d1a
+ *
  */
